School Overview
Patuxent Appeal Elementary Campus, located in Lusby, Maryland, serves as a primary educational institution within the Calvert County Public Schools district. The school is dedicated to fostering a supportive and engaging learning environment that emphasizes academic growth, social-emotional development, and the cultivation of foundational skills for its young student population. By integrating a comprehensive curriculum with a focus on student-centered instruction, the campus aims to prepare children for success in their future academic endeavors while promoting a sense of community and responsibility.
Beyond its core academic offerings, Patuxent Appeal Elementary is known for its commitment to building strong partnerships between educators, students, and families. The school actively encourages parental involvement and community engagement, recognizing that a collaborative approach is essential for student success. Through a variety of programs, extracurricular activities, and a dedicated staff, the campus strives to create an inclusive atmosphere where every child is encouraged to reach their full potential, ensuring a well-rounded educational experience in a safe and welcoming setting.

School Details
| Status: | Open |
|---|---|
| School Level: | Elementary School |
| School Type: | Regular School |
| Charter Status:* | Public Non-Charter |
| Virtual Instruction: | No virtual instruction |
| Shared Time Status: | No |
| District: | Calvert County Public Schools |
| Phone: | (443)550-9710 |
| Grade Range: | Pre-K - 5th |
| Total Students: | 641 |
| Full-Time Teachers (FTE): | 45.3 |
| Pupil/Teacher Ratio: | 14.2 |
| NSLP Participation:1 | Yes participating without using any Provision or the CEO |
| Qualified Free Lunch: | 321 |
| Qualified Reduced Lunch: | 62 |
